FU(H4DOTC)-67

Fuel Filler Pipe

FUEL INJECTION (FUEL SYSTEMS)

B: INSTALLATION

1) Open the fuel filler lid.
2) Set the fuel saucer (A) with rubber gasket (C),
and insert the fuel filler pipe into hole from the inner
side of apron.
3) Align the holes in fuel filler pipe neck and set the
cup (B), and tighten the screws.

NOTE:
If the edges of rubber gasket are folded toward in-
side, straighten it with a flat tip screwdriver.

4) Securely insert the fuel filler hose (A) and evap-
oration hose (B) into the specified position, then at-
tach the clamp or clip as shown in the figure.

Tightening torque:

2.5 N·m (0.3 kgf-m, 1.8 ft-lb)

FU(H4DOTC)-68

Fuel Filler Pipe

FUEL INJECTION (FUEL SYSTEMS)

5) Tighten the bolts which hold fuel filler pipe brack-
et on the body.

Tightening torque:

7.5 N·m (0.8 kgf-m, 5.5 ft-lb)

6) Install the rear sub frame. <Ref. to RS-21, IN-
STALLATION, Rear Sub Frame.>
7) Install the mud guard. <Ref. to EI-29, INSTAL-
LATION, Mud Guard.>
8) Lower the vehicle.
9) Install the rear wheel RH.

Tightening torque:

120 N·m (12.2 kgf-m, 88.5 ft-lb)

10) Connect the ground cable to battery.

11) Inspect the wheel alignment and adjust if nec-
essary.

C: INSPECTION

1) Check that the fuel filler pipe does not have
holes or cracks, nor damaged in any way.
2) Make sure that the fuel hose is not cracked and
that the connections are tight.

D: DISASSEMBLY

1) Move the clip and disconnect the evaporation
hose from the shut valve.

2) Remove the nut which holds the evaporation
pipe assembly to the fuel filler pipe.

3) Remove the shut valve from the fuel filler pipe.
<Ref. to EC(H4DOTC)-18, REMOVAL, Shut Valve.>

FU(H4DOTC)-69

Fuel Filler Pipe

FUEL INJECTION (FUEL SYSTEMS)

E: ASSEMBLY

1) Install the shut valve to the fuel filler pipe. 
<Ref. to EC(H4DOTC)-18, INSTALLATION, Shut
Valve.>
2) Tighten the nuts which secure the evaporation
pipe assembly to the fuel filler pipe.

Tightening torque:

7.5 N·m (0.8 kgf-m, 5.5 ft-lb)

3) Connect the evaporation hose to the shut valve.

FU(H4DOTC)-70

Fuel Pump

FUEL INJECTION (FUEL SYSTEMS)

29.Fuel Pump

A: REMOVAL

WARNING:
Place “NO OPEN FLAMES” signs near the
working area.

CAUTION:
• Be careful not to spill fuel.
• If the fuel gauge indicates that two thirds or
more of the fuel is remaining, be sure to drain
fuel before starting work to avoid the fuel to
spill.

NOTE:
Fuel pump assembly consists of fuel pump, fuel fil-
ter and fuel level sensor.
1) Release the fuel pressure. <Ref. to
FU(H4DOTC)-57, RELEASING OF FUEL PRES-
SURE, PROCEDURE, Fuel.>
2) Drain fuel. <Ref. to FU(H4DOTC)-57, DRAIN-
ING FUEL (WITH SUBARU SELECT MONITOR),
PROCEDURE, Fuel.>
3) Disconnect the ground cable from battery.

4) Remove the rear seat.
5) Remove the service hole cover.

6) Disconnect the connector from fuel pump.

7) Disconnect the quick connector of fuel delivery
tube, fuel return tube and jet pump tube. <Ref. to
FU(H4DOTC)-80, REMOVAL, Fuel Delivery, Re-
turn and Evaporation Lines.>
8) Remove the nuts which install fuel pump assem-
bly onto fuel tank.

9) Remove the fuel pump assembly from the fuel
tank.
